the Colorado County lies in the US Federal State Texas in the USA. In the year 2000 the County had 20,390 inhabitants and a population density of 8 inhabitants/km ². The seat of the County administration is in Columbus.

Table of contents

geography

the County is appropriate southeast the geographical center from Texas, for about 100 km before the gulf of Mexico and has a surface of 2522 km ², about which 28 km ² water surface is. The County borders in the clockwise direction on the Counties: Austin County, Wharton County, Jackson County, Lavaca County and Fayette County.

history

Colorado County was formed 1836 as original County. It was designated after the Colorado River.

demographic data

the average income of a household is about 32.425 USD. The average income of a family with 41.388 USD. Men have an average income of 30.063 USD opposite the women with on the average 20,014 USD. The Pro-Kopf-Einkommen is with 16.910 USD. 16.20% the inhabitant and 12.30% of the families live below the poverty border.
25.6% the inhabitant are old under 18 years and on 100 women starting from 18 years and over it come statistically 92.4 men. The average age amounts to 39 years. (Conditions: 2000).
